Nobody Achieves Anything Alone: The Power of Building Your Own Community

Ever heard that saying, “no man is an island”? Well, it’s bang on, especially when we talk about making your mark in the world. Sure, we all love those rags-to-riches stories where the hero pulls themselves up by their bootstraps and makes it big. But let’s get real: behind every “solo” success is a crew of supporters, mentors, friends, and, yes, even critics, all playing their part.

Solo Success? Nah, It’s a Team Effort

Think about it. The whole idea of doing everything solo, climbing that mountain all by yourself, is pretty much a myth. There’s always someone in the mix, helping out. It could be the friend who gives you a pep talk, the mentor who guides you, or the community that’s got your back. Success is a group project, even if you’re the one in the spotlight.

Why Your Community Matters

Creating your vibe tribe isn’t just about networking or collecting business cards. It’s about building real connections that go both ways. These are the folks who’ll be your cheerleaders, your brainstorming buddies, and your reality check when you need it.

Better Together: Imagine a potluck dinner. Everyone brings their own dish, their unique flavor, and voilà, you’ve got a feast. That’s your community. Everyone’s experiences and skills mix together to create something amazing that no one could’ve done on their own.

Got Your Back: The road to your goals can get bumpy. Having a squad means there’s always someone to lift you up when you stumble, cheer you on, and celebrate your wins. It’s like having a safety net that catches you and bounces you back up.

Open Doors: Ever heard of the saying, “It’s not what you know, but who you know”? Well, there’s truth to it. Your community can hook you up with opportunities you wouldn’t find on your own. It’s like having a bunch of keys to different doors, and you get to explore what’s behind them.

Never Stop Learning: Being part of a group is like being in the ultimate masterclass. You’re always learning, growing, and getting better at your game. It’s all about swapping stories, sharing what you know, and picking up new tricks along the way.

Making It Happen

So, how do you build this magical community? Start by reaching out, sharing your dreams, and listening. Create spaces where everyone can share, connect, and support each other. And remember, it’s as much about giving as it is about getting. Help others shine, and you’ll find yourself shining too.

The Bottom Line

The whole “nobody achieves anything alone” thing is your invitation to dive into the world of community building. It’s not just about making your journey easier; it’s about enriching your journey with different perspectives, support, and, most importantly, friendship.
